Skip to content

Instantly share code, notes, and snippets.

@demohero101
Created February 20, 2022 14:23
Show Gist options
  • Save demohero101/b8d4f9f8e6ca4325164e256ac60f8fde to your computer and use it in GitHub Desktop.
Save demohero101/b8d4f9f8e6ca4325164e256ac60f8fde to your computer and use it in GitHub Desktop.
ModulesOrnekler
# Modül oluşturma örnek
def greet(name):
print("Merhaba " + name)
--------
# Import
import mymodule
mymodule.greet("Ahmet")
***************************************
# Modül oluşturma örnek
def add(a, b):
result = a + b
return result
def multiply(a, b):
result = a * b
return result
-------
# Import 1
import mymodule
print(mymodule.add(5,5))
print(mymodule.multiply(5,5))
# Import 2
import mymodule
a = 5
b = 5
result = mymodule.add(a, b)
print(result)
--------------------------------
# Modül oluşturma örnek
# Sözlük
person1 = {
"name" : "Murat",
"job" : "Öğretmen",
"age" : 45
}
person2 = {
"name" : "Nihal",
"job" : "Doktor",
"age" : 40
}
-------------------------------
# Belli yapıları import etmek
from mymodule import person1
print(person1["name"])
---
from mymodule import person2
print(person2["name"])
---
# Tüm yapıları import etmek
from mymodule import *
print(person1["name"])
print(person2["name"])
---------------------------------
# Modül ismi değiştirmek
import mymodule as mymod
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ment